Advertisement

家谱表示法在数据机构课程设计中的应用(孩子兄弟表示法)

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本研究探讨了家谱表示法中孩子兄弟表示法在家谱树存储和查询中的优势,并展示了其在数据结构教学与实践中的创新应用。 大二的时候学习数据结构时完成的一个项目包括以下功能:(1)在家谱中添加新成员,并将其追加到文件中。(2) 输出指定家庭的所有成员。(3) 确定指定成员在家族中的辈份,即其属于哪一代。(4) 列出特定代际的所有成员。此外还可以显示所有家庭成员。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• 优质
    本研究探讨了家谱表示法中孩子兄弟表示法在家谱树存储和查询中的优势,并展示了其在数据结构教学与实践中的创新应用。 大二的时候学习数据结构时完成的一个项目包括以下功能:(1)在家谱中添加新成员,并将其追加到文件中。(2) 输出指定家庭的所有成员。(3) 确定指定成员在家族中的辈份,即其属于哪一代。(4) 列出特定代际的所有成员。此外还可以显示所有家庭成员。
  • -树结
    优质
    本段介绍如何使用兄弟链表(Sibling-Child Representation)来表示和操作树形数据结构。通过节点同时存储子节点和同级兄弟节点的信息,提供了一种灵活高效的树状结构实现方法。 已知一棵树的由根至叶子结点按层次输入的结点序列及每个结点的度(每层中自左至右输入),请编写构造此树的孩子—兄弟链表表示法的算法。
  • -基础算-
    优质
    简介:本课程讲解数据结构中的“孩子兄弟链表”,一种灵活表示树形结构的方法,并深入探讨其在基础算法中的应用。 数据结构-基本算法-孩子兄弟链表(学生时代源码,调试可运行)。
  • 关于树代码.rar
    优质
    本资源包含关于“孩子兄弟”表示法在树数据结构中的实现代码,适用于学习和理解二叉树的不同遍历方法及存储方式。 树的孩子兄弟表示法代码用C++编写并已调试通过,适合初学者下载学习。这份资料特别为刚入门数据结构的同学准备(缺少查找双亲的代码)。
  • 优质
    本文探讨了将家谱概念融入大学数据结构课程设计的可能性与优势,展示了如何通过创建家谱项目帮助学生更好地理解和掌握复杂的数据结构原理。 数据结构课程设计——家谱项目已经完成以下功能: 1. 输入文件用于存放初始家谱成员的信息,包括姓名、出生日期、婚姻状态、地址、是否健在以及死亡日期(如果适用)。可以添加其他相关信息。 2. 实现了数据的保存和读取操作。 3. 以图形方式展示完整的家谱图。 4. 显示第n代所有人的详细信息。 5. 支持根据姓名或出生日期查询并输出成员及其父亲、子女的信息。 6. 输入两个人的名字,确定他们之间的关系。 7. 允许为某个家庭成员添加孩子。 8. 删除指定的家庭成员(如果该人有后代,则会一并将后代删除)。 9. 按照出生日期对家谱中的所有人进行排序。 10. 当打开一个家谱时,系统将提示当天生日的健在人员。 总的来说,这个项目达到了预期的效果。虽然部分功能借鉴了网络上的资源,但已经进行了适当的参考和调整。
  • 二叉链-)存储结实现
    优质
    本项目实现了基于二叉链表(孩子-兄弟表示法)的数据结构中树的各种操作,包括节点插入、删除及遍历等算法。 C语言数据结构抽象数据类型的实现——树 利用二叉链表的存储结构进行开发,使用VC++作为开发工具。
  • 哈希
    优质
    本文探讨了哈希表在数据结构课程设计中的重要性及其具体应用场景,旨在通过实例展示其高效的数据存储和检索能力。 为了在一个集体(例如班级)内针对“人名”设计一个哈希表,并确保平均查找长度不超过2,需要完成建表和查表程序的设计。假设给定的人名为中国人姓名的汉语拼音形式,总共有30个人名需填入该哈希表中。采用除留余数法来构造哈希函数,并使用伪随机探测再散列方法解决冲突问题。
  • 哈希
    优质
    本项目探讨了哈希表在数据结构课程设计中的应用,通过实例展示了如何利用哈希表高效地解决查找、插入和删除操作问题。 有完整能运行的代码和完整的课程设计文档报告。
  • 城市链
    优质
    本项目探讨了将城市链表应用于数据结构课程设计中,旨在通过实际案例增强学生对链表操作和管理的理解。 电子工业出版社的数据结构课程设计要求将若干城市的信息存入一个带头结点的单链表中。每个节点包含城市的名称及其位置坐标。该设计需要能够通过城市名或位置坐标进行查找、插入、删除及更新等操作。
  • 简单实现
    优质
    本文章介绍了如何通过编程语言(如C++或Python)实现“左孩子右兄弟”表示法,并附有简单的代码示例。这种数据结构用于存储树形结构的数据,是另一种形式的二叉树实现方式。 这是数据结构中树的基本实现,使用C++语言编写,并采用了左孩子右兄弟的结构形式。该实现包含了各种操作的类成员函数。